Abstract

A torque converter includes a front cover, an output shaft member, a piston, a clutch, an impeller, and a turbine. The piston is supported by the output shaft member. The piston slides on the output shaft member in an axial direction. The piston extends in a radial direction. The clutch is disposed between the front cover and the piston. The impeller includes an impeller shell and an impeller blade. The impeller shell is fixed to the front cover. The impeller blade is attached to the impeller shell. The turbine includes a turbine shell, a turbine blade and a connecting portion. The turbine shell is disposed in opposition to the impeller. The turbine blade is attached to the turbine shell. The connecting portion connects the piston and the turbine shell so as to make the piston and the turbine shell unitarily rotatable.
